WebThe “trick” is how to determine those ionization energies. Well, if the Energy of the photon (E photon) is known, all we need to do is to determine the kinetic energy of a given, ejected electron (KE electron) . The difference between those two energies MUST be the energy needed to “dislodge” the electron from it’s nucleus. IE ... WebSecond, Third, Fourth, and Higher Ionization Energies. By now you know that sodium forms Na + ions, magnesium forms Mg 2+ ions, and aluminum forms Al 3+ ions. But have you ever wondered why sodium doesn't form Na 2+ ions, or even Na 3+ ions? The answer can be obtained from data for the second, third, and higher ionization energies of the … WebThe noble gases already have a complete set of electrons, and an additional electron must go into the next highest shell, which will cost energy to start populating. WebIonization energy is the amount of energy necessary to remove an electron from an atom. The ionization energy tends to increase from left to right across the periodic table because of the increase number of protons in the nucleus of the atom. Web16 sep. 2024 · Typical units for ionization energies are kilojoules/mole (kJ/mol) or electron volts (eV): 1 eV / atom = 96.49kJ / mol. If an atom possesses more than one … WebIt is customary to express the ionization energy in electron volts, 1eV = 1.602 × 10−12 erg. Ionization of the most abundant elements, hydrogen and helium, is important for the equation of state. For these elements we have: ionization of hydrogen: χ = 13.54 eV , 2gi+1/gi = 1, first ionization of helium: χ = 24.48 eV , 2gi+1/gi = 4,

http://www.pinchaschemsite.com/uploads/9/0/3/9/9039911/pes.pdf Web1 nov. 2024 · Example 4: The first, second, and third ionization energies of Aluminium are 578, 1817, and 2745 kJ/mol. Calculate the ionization energy required to convert Al ion to Al 3+. Given, ΔH 1 = 578, ΔH 2 = 1817, ΔH 3 = 2745. 3+ ΔE = ΔH 1 + ΔH 2 + ΔH 3. ΔE = 578+1817+2745 = 5140 kJ/mol. WebPhotoelectron spectrometers work by ionizing samples using high-energy radiation (such as UV or x-rays) and then measuring the kinetic energies ( \text {KE} KE ) of the ejected electrons. Given the energy of the incident radiation ( h\nu hν ) and the \text {KE} KE of the photoelectrons, the binding energy ( \text {BE} BE

Since going from right to left on the periodic … pregnancy birth deliveryscotchman peak trailheadWebIn the useful range between 200 and 500 K all donors are ionised, we can assume n = N D. For lower temperatures the electron density freezes out with an activation energy of half the donor depth. Thus, Hall measurements at different temperatures can be used to find the activation energy for donor ionisation. scotchman peak hikeWebIonization energy graph of Boron The atomic number of Boron is 5.
